Opting for Between JD and LLB Degrees
When embarking on a legal career, prospective lawyers often arrive at a crucial juncture: picking between a Juris Doctor (JD) and a Bachelor of Laws (LLB). Though both degrees train students for legal roles, there are key differences in their structure, content, and intended goals. The JD, primarily offered in the United States, focuses on practical legal abilities, while the LLB, more prevalent in common law systems, provides a broader framework in legal theory.
- Additionally, the JD typically culminates with clinical learning opportunities, allowing students to use their knowledge in real-world settings.
- Conversely, the LLB often highlights on legal research and abstract framework
Finally, the best choice between a JD and an LLB depends on an individual's objectives for their legal profession.
